First I bought the Bushnell ERS 3.5 - 21 x 50 scope with the Horus H59 reticle because I got an excellent price.
Then fate came along and the Ruger Precision Rifle was announced. a few months later I got lucky again and got a 6.5 Creedmoor RPR. I mounted the ERS scope on a Nightforce Unmount and have been shooting 1/2" groups ever since (when there is no wind ;o) To me this combination is a very good moderately priced scope ($1,700.) with a very good moderately priced rifle ($1,000. + tax). Since then I've added a Little Bastard muzzle brake, LRI aluminum bolt shroud and a modular MAGPUL pistol grip. I really love this rifle/scope combo. Very accurate using Hornady ELD-M 140 gr. rounds. |
